Answer:
35 units
Step-by-step explanation:
Perimeter of rectangle ABCD =2(L + W)
L = AD or BC (we only need to calculate one of the two)
W = AB or DC. (we only need to calculate one of the two).
Distance between A(-2, 6) and D(-8, -4):
\( AD = \sqrt{(x_2 - x_1)^2 + (y_2 - y_1)^2} \)
Let,
\( A(-2, 6) = (x_1, y_1) \)
\( D(-8, -4) = (x_2, y_2) \)
\( AD = \sqrt{(-8 -(-2))^2 + (-4 - 6)^2} \)
\( AD = \sqrt{(-6)^2 + (-10)^2} \)
\( AD = \sqrt{36 + 100} = \sqrt{136} \)
\( AD = 11.7 \) (nearest tenth)
Distance between A(-2, 6) and B(3, 3):
\( AD = \sqrt{(x_2 - x_1)^2 + (y_2 - y_1)^2} \)
Let,
\( A(-2, 6) = (x_1, y_1) \)
\( B(3, 3) = (x_2, y_2) \)
\( AB = \sqrt{(3 -(-2))^2 + (3 - 6)^2} \)
\( AB = \sqrt{(5)^2 + (-3)^2} \)
\( AB = \sqrt{25 + 9} = \sqrt{34} \)
\( AB = 5.8 \) (nearest tenth)
Perimeter of rectangle ABCD =2(AD + AB)
= 2(11.7 + 5.8)
= 2(17.5)
= 35 units

Two bikers start at the same place and same time. The first biker rides east at a constant velocity of 5 miles per hour and the second biker rides north at a constant velocity of 12 miles per hour. Approximately how fast (in mph) is the distance between them changing after 3 hours?
A. 5
B. 7
C. 12
D. 13
E. 17
9514 1404 393
Answer:
D. 13
Step-by-step explanation:
The distance between the bikers is the hypotenuse of a right triangle whose legs are a linear function of time. It will be ...
d(t) = √((5t)² +(12t)²) = √((25 +144)t²) = 13t
The distance between the bikers is increasing at the constant rate of 13 miles per hour. The rate is still 13 miles per hour after 3 hours.

The length of the longer leg of a right triangle is 4ft more than twice the length of the shorter leg. The length of the hypotenuse is 6ft more than twice the length of the shorter leg. Find the side lengths of the triangle.
a. Find the length of the shorter side
b. Find the length of the longer side
c. Find the length of the hypotenuse
d. Find the side lengths of the triangle.
Answer: Shorter side = 10 feet
Longer side = 24 feet
Hypotenuse = 26 feet
The side lengths of the triangle are 10ft, 24ft and 26ft.
Step-by-step explanation:
Let the length of the shorter leg be x.
The length of the longer leg of a right triangle is 4ft more than twice the length of the shorter leg. This will be: = 2x + 4
The length of the hypotenuse is 6ft more than twice the length of the shorter leg. This will be: = 2x + 6
Note that the square of the hypothenuse will be equal to the square of the other two sides. This will be:
x² + (2x + 4)² = (2x + 6)²
x² + (2x + 4)(2x + 4) = (2x + 6)(2x + 6)
x² + 4x² + 8x + 8x + 16 = 4x² + 12x + 12x + 36
x² + 4x² + 16x + 16 = 4x² + 24x + 36
5x² + 16x + 16 = 4x² + 24x + 36
Collect like terms
5x² - 4x² + 16x - 24x + 16 - 36 = 0
x² - 8x - 20 = 0
x² - 10x + 2x - 20 = 0
x(x - 10) + 2(x - 10) = 0
Therefore, x - 10 = 0
x = 10
a. length of the shorter side = 10ft
b. Length of the longer side = 2x + 4 = 2(10) + 4 = 20 + 4 = 24ft
c. length of the hypotenuse = 2x + 6 = 2(10) + 6 = 20 + 6 = 26ft
d. The side lengths of the triangle are 10ft, 24ft and 26ft.
